Différences
Ci-dessous, les différences entre deux révisions de la page.
Les deux révisions précédentes Révision précédente Prochaine révision | Révision précédente Prochaine révision Les deux révisions suivantes | ||
autofs [Le 26/11/2018, 12:31] bcag2 [SAMBA - CIFS] typo |
autofs [Le 15/06/2020, 01:35] 82.238.203.221 |
||
---|---|---|---|
Ligne 143: | Ligne 143: | ||
<note tip> | <note tip> | ||
- | En cas de pb au montage (dossier introuvable), essayer de déclarer dans le auto.nfs le répertoire père du répertoire partagé sur le serveur. | + | En cas de problème au montage (dossier introuvable), essayer de déclarer dans le auto.nfs le répertoire père du répertoire partagé sur le serveur. |
Exemple: | Exemple: | ||
Ligne 180: | Ligne 180: | ||
Si vous avez déjà une solution via fstab, n'oubliez pas de commenter les lignes dans /etc/fstab et de démonter les montages avant de mettre en place cette solution. | Si vous avez déjà une solution via fstab, n'oubliez pas de commenter les lignes dans /etc/fstab et de démonter les montages avant de mettre en place cette solution. | ||
- | Si le serveur (montage samba) n'est pas accessible cela empêche l'explorateur de fichier nautilus de démarrer. Dans ce cas ouvrir une console et taper | + | Si le serveur (montage samba) n'est pas accessible, cela empêche l'explorateur de fichier nautilus de démarrer. Dans ce cas ouvrir une console et taper |
sudo service autofs stop | sudo service autofs stop | ||
=== Installer autofs et cifs === | === Installer autofs et cifs === | ||
- | sudo apt-get install autofs cifs-utils | + | sudo apt-get install autofs cifs-utils |
=== création du credential === | === création du credential === | ||
Ligne 216: | Ligne 216: | ||
* N'oubliez pas de valoriser "<user>" par votre login sur le client | * N'oubliez pas de valoriser "<user>" par votre login sur le client | ||
* /mnt doit exister | * /mnt doit exister | ||
- | * nas ne doit pas exister et sera le nom du répertoire créé automatiquement pas autofs sous /mnt (ie /mnt/nas) | + | * nas ne doit pas exister et sera le nom du répertoire créé automatiquement pas autofs sous /mnt (i.e. /mnt/nas) |
- | * nomDuNas peut être remplacer par l'adresse ip du (serveur) NAS. Attention dans le cas d'un serveur windows il faut remplacer le nom du serveur par l'adresse IP, la résolution du nom de domaine ne se faisant pas , | + | * nomDuNas peut être remplacé par l'adresse IP du (serveur) NAS. Attention dans le cas d'un serveur Windows, il faut remplacer le nom du serveur par l'adresse IP, la résolution du nom de domaine ne se faisant pas , |
<note important>Bien précéder le nom du serveur par le caractère ` **:** ` ((https://help.ubuntu.com/community/Autofs#FUSE_based_file_systems))</note> | <note important>Bien précéder le nom du serveur par le caractère ` **:** ` ((https://help.ubuntu.com/community/Autofs#FUSE_based_file_systems))</note> | ||
* testé avec succès avec un NAS synology DS214 | * testé avec succès avec un NAS synology DS214 | ||
Ligne 224: | Ligne 224: | ||
sudo usermod -aG users loginUtilisateur | sudo usermod -aG users loginUtilisateur | ||
- | Il faut quitter la session et la réouvrir pour que le changement prenne effet. | + | Il faut quitter la session et la rouvrir pour que le changement prenne effet. |
Quelques options supplémentaires : | Quelques options supplémentaires : | ||
Ligne 230: | Ligne 230: | ||
* file_mode=0750, | * file_mode=0750, | ||
* dir_mode=0750, | * dir_mode=0750, | ||
- | <note important>//file_mode// et //dir_mode// en 0777 n'est pas indispensables pour un partage Windows, même si on veut avoir un accès en écriture! Il suffit que l'utilisateur Windows utilisé pour la connexion (dans le fichier de credentials) ait les droits d'écriture sur le dossier partagé. | + | <note important>//file_mode// et //dir_mode// en 0777 n'est pas indispensables pour un partage Windows, même si on veut avoir un accès en écriture ! Il suffit que l'utilisateur Windows utilisé pour la connexion (dans le fichier de credentials) ait les droits d'écriture sur le dossier partagé. |
- | Par ailleurs, si on précise le username dans le fichier de credentials, il est inutile de le re-spécifier dans les options du mount. Et uid et gid ne doivent pas forcément être des valeurs numériques. | + | Par ailleurs, si on précise le username dans le fichier de credentials, il est inutile de le re spécifier dans les options du mount. Et uid et gid ne doivent pas forcément être des valeurs numériques. |
Voir mount.cifs(8) | Voir mount.cifs(8) | ||
</note> | </note> | ||
Ligne 238: | Ligne 238: | ||
- | Pour finir Redémarrez autofs : | + | Pour finir, redémarrez autofs : |
sudo service autofs restart | sudo service autofs restart | ||
Ligne 255: | Ligne 255: | ||
Remarques : | Remarques : | ||
* remplacer "<user>" par le login linux du pc client de l'utilisateur | * remplacer "<user>" par le login linux du pc client de l'utilisateur | ||
- | * des erreurs devraient être retourner et doivent permettre une analyse du problème | + | * des erreurs devraient être retournées pour permettre une analyse du problème |
| | ||
- | Une fois que le mount marche. Démonter : | + | Une fois que le mount marche, démonter : |
sudo umount /mnt | sudo umount /mnt | ||
Ligne 281: | Ligne 281: | ||
>> mount: unknown filesystem type 'cif' | >> mount: unknown filesystem type 'cif' | ||
- | Au moins on sait ou chercher. Ici par exemple un problème de résolution de nom et une option de montage avec une erreur de saisie (cif au lieu de cifs) | + | Au moins on sait où chercher. Ici par exemple, un problème de résolution de nom et une option de montage avec une erreur de saisie (cif au lieu de cifs) |